Why You Do Not Want Termites Around Your Dallas Home

Termites eat through wooden structures as they consume the cellulose fibers inside of wood. This means that they can damage all kinds of wooden items around your home or business, from wooden fences to support beams to flooring and more. The amount of damage they cause can vary depending on how long the infestation is allowed to remain and how severe it gets. It can sometimes take over a year for termite damage to show up, but termites can cost you thousands of dollars in repairs.

When the termite infestation starts, you might not even see any actual termites. The time of year known as termite season, between spring and fall, is when you’re most likely to see these pests as some of them will leave the nests to reproduce. The termites that leave the nest have wings and are called termite swarmers.

What Do Termites Look Like In Dallas?

As mentioned above, different termites in the colony play different roles. The worker and soldier termites don’t have wings, and they rarely leave the nest. They are a whitish color but sometimes have darker heads. On the other hand, the termite swarmers are dark brown to black and do have wings. These are the termites that you’re most likely to see, especially during termite season. But, even still, you might not even notice them at all.

Five Termite Prevention Tips

The best way to prevent termites is with assistance from the termite control pros at Lonestar Safe Pest, but there are also a few easy ways to prevent termites on your own. These steps will help you address the underlying factors that attract termites in the first place. Here is what you should do:

  • Install a barrier around the foundation of the structure to limit soil-to-wood contact.
  • Reduce moisture problems around your property by removing standing water and fixing leaky plumbing.
  • Store firewood and other woodpiles at least 30 feet away from the exterior of the building.
  • Replace weather-stripping and fix holes in the foundation using caulk.
  • Get rid of any rotting or water-damaged woods.
